Claim This Listing - FreeTurant provides a robust identity and authorization layer designed specifically for the AI era. It seamlessly verifies exactly who is speaking before an AI agent, radio network, smart device, enterprise application, or autonomous system is allowed to take action. Built for versatility and speed, Turant operates efficiently whether online or offline, and can be deployed in the cloud or directly at the edge. By delivering highly accurate voice-based identity verification in under a second, it bridges the gap between advanced AI capabilities and strict security requirements.

The hero section is the most expensive real estate on your website. Currently, the messaging leans too heavily on technical terminology and fails to immediately quantify the business value.
The Problem: Typical B2B AI headlines rely on buzzwords like "Next-Gen," "AI-Powered," or "Voice Biometrics." This tells the user what the product is, but it does not tell them what the product does for them.
Why it matters: Visitors decide whether to stay or bounce in milliseconds. If a Chief Information Security Officer (CISO) or Call Center Director cannot instantly see how you solve their fraud or latency problems, they will leave.
Recommended fix: Pivot the headline to focus on the ultimate benefit: eliminating fraud and reducing friction.

The Problem: The supporting text tries to cram too many features (language agnostic, deepfake detection, continuous authentication) into one block of text. This creates cognitive overload.
Why it matters: Dense paragraphs destroy readability. Enterprise buyers skim for keywords related to their specific pain points.
Recommended fix: Keep the subheadline to two lines maximum. Focus on the speed of integration and the accuracy of the authentication.

The Problem: The current copy suffers from the "curse of knowledge." It is written by brilliant engineers, for other engineers.
Why it matters: The people writing the checks—VP of Fraud, VP of Customer Experience, or CISO—care about metrics. They care about reducing Average Handle Time (AHT), stopping account takeovers (ATO), and preventing deepfake attacks.

Lead with the "Why Now" (Deepfakes): Your hero section needs to address the immediate, modern threat. Instead of a generic hook about "Secure Voice Authentication," pivot to the pain point. Actionable fix: Change the headline to something like, "Protect your business from AI voice clones and deepfakes in under 2 seconds."
Translate Tech-Speak into Business Outcomes: Shift the copy from engineering terminology to ROI and security benefits. Actionable fix:
Define and Segment the Personas: Enterprise buyers need to see themselves on your page. Right now, the positioning is too horizontal. Actionable fix: Add dedicated use-case blocks for "Call Centers" (focus: reducing Average Handle Time and friction) and "Financial Services" (focus: stopping Account Takeovers and ensuring compliance).
Quantify the Competitive Edge: Make your speed and frictionless nature undeniable compared to legacy competitors that require long passphrases. Actionable fix: Boldly highlight metrics on the page. Emphasize "Zero wake words," "< 2 seconds to verify," and frame them around how much time and money this saves an enterprise at scale.
Bottom line: Turant.ai has built highly relevant, powerful technology perfectly timed for the generative AI era, but the landing page currently reads too much like an engineering spec sheet. By pivoting the messaging from how the technology works to the financial and security disasters it prevents, Turant can transition from an interesting AI tool to an absolute enterprise necessity.
